Kristy joined Carlson Veit Junge Architects in 2021 as an Interior Designer. She graduated in 2017 from Kirkwood Community College located in Cedar Rapids, Iowa with a degree in Interior Design. She has been involved in the International Interior Design Association (IIDA) for the last eight years, volunteering on the board for two, and is in the process of studying for her NCIDQ certification exams. In addition to a strong background in drafting and space planning, Kristy has always been very creative, incorporating these skills well throughout her designs. Kristy’s strengths include understanding the client’s objectives and creating a functional yet aesthetically appealing design that fits their overall needs.
